February 17, 1944 - The Anamosa Journal

Funeral service for Mrs. Olive Waggoner Smith, 68, who died at Van Meter, S. Dak., Feb. 12, was held at the Smykil funeral home Wednesday afternoon. Rev. J. K. Delahooke of the Methodist church was the officiating minister.

Burial was in the Antioch cemetery.

Mrs. Smith was born July 23, 1875, near Rockford, Ill. She came to Iowa with her parents at the age of three years, settling near Marion, where they lived until 1895. She married John Waggoner in 1893, and they moved to Anamosa in 1895. There were three children, Mrs. Ivy Meredith, Anamosa; Mrs. Verna Woodrow, Independence, Kan., and Mrs. Leone Bloodgood, Huron, S. Dak.

Mr. Waggoner died Feb. 1, 1902. She married Will Smith in August 1903. They moved to Van Meter, S. Dak., where she lived until she died. Mr. Smith died in August, 1942.

Surviving are her three daughters, six grandchildren and five sisters, Mrs. Alma Flaherty, Mrs. Blanche Banadom, Mrs. Harry Day, Anamosa; Mrs. Ina Martiletti, Lansing, Mich., Mrs. Myrtle Allee, Minneapolis, Minn. A sister and brother preceded her in death.
